Parallel parking along the houses is always free. I've been tailgating over there for years and they've never ticketed people parking in the Fraternity spots, but every year is a new "will they ticket those spots?" question. As for the meter spots on the street, as long as you're in the spot itself, you won't be ticketed, whether you pay the meter or not. If you're on yellow, though, they will tow you. Learned that lesson once and will forever remember it.
Generally you can get a spot as late as 10-11. First of all, I'd recommend leaving a car the night before with all your gear. If you aren't able to do that, then 9am or before is your best bet to get a parking spot close enough to not break out into a sweat loading and unloading the car.
as long as what you have is in a cup, you'll be just fine. Don't have a case of beer sitting out. Any alcohol should be in a closed cooler or hidden under a table. Don't try bringing a keg. It will be caught and it will not work. I've seen it get caught over and over.
It's a little over half a mile from Fiji Island to Neyland.
